Farmington Hills company gets furniture contractNorthwest Airlines has awarded Farmington Hills-based University Business Interiors a $3 million contract to supply all of the furniture, with the exception of gate seating, for the new terminal at Detroit Metropolitan Airport. University Business Interiors will supply and install office furniture, outdoor seating, auditorium seating, free standing desks, work stations, tables, garbage receptacles and passenger stanchions for the new terminal, which is scheduled to open in December. The company also will furnish the Northwest WorldKids Club. "These furnishings will provide comfort and utility for our customers and employees while contributing to the modern, world-class design that will distinguish the new terminal," said Jim Greenwald, Northwest vice president - facilities and airport affairs. "We are also delighted that a Michigan-based company is playing this type of role in a project that will have such a positive impact on this State." "We are excited to be part of this dynamic project and participate in the growth of the metro Detroit area," said Joseph Lozowski, University Business Interiors owner and president. "This is a great opportunity." About half of the furniture supplied by University Business Interiors will be of the Premise line from Haworth, Inc., a Holland, Michigan-based designer, manufacturer and marketer of office furniture. University Business Interiors will supply and install the remaining items of the order from other specialty vendors. The new terminal will feature 97 gates, 18 luggage carousels, an 11,500 space parking garage, an Express Tram system and more than 80 shops and restaurants in an open and spacious environment. Part of a public-private partnership between Wayne County, which operates the airport, and Northwest Airlines, the project has approximately 10 months remaining in a five-year design and construction process. More than 1,200 workers are now involved in construction of the terminal. Officials for both the airline and Wayne County expect it to rank as one of the world's finest air facilities after it opens in December. |
